Approach-Avoidance Conflict
A psychological struggle where a single goal or option has both appealing and repelling aspects, causing conflict.
Attack-Avoidance Conflict
A psychological conflict that occurs when an individual is motivated to approach or attack a goal but also wishes to avoid it due to perceived negative consequences.
Avoidance-Avoidance Conflict
A psychological conflict that occurs when an individual is forced to choose between two equally unattractive options or outcomes.
